第2篇:Flowable启动

接上一篇:
第1篇:Flowable简介
https://blog.csdn.net/weixin_40816738/article/details/102875266

Flowable启动

一、Flowable部署包分析

1.1. tomcat版本

在上一节我们下载了Flowable的部署安装包,tomcat版本解压后如下:
在这里插入图片描述
核心的代码在webapps下面,其中flowable的相关的代码包如下:
在这里插入图片描述

模块说明
flowable-idm.war该服务主要集成了用户管理、权限管理、组管理、单点登录功能,是modeler等依赖的一个基础用户服务。
flowable-modeler.war核心的业务绘制模块,提供了一个Web化的编辑器,可以在线编辑业务流程,绘制业务表单,编辑决策表,发布应用程序,编写Case模型的功能。
flowable-admin.war管理端的程序,可以查询流程引擎、CMMN引擎、App引擎、表单引擎、DMN引擎、Content引擎的相关信息,并且提供一定的管理能力。
flowable-task.war任务管理程序,提供任务、流程、Case的启动停止能力,并且可以编辑任务的操作步骤。

1.2. WAR版本

WAR版本的目录结构如下:
在这里插入图片描述

程序包主要位于wars里面,wars的目录结构如下:在这里插入图片描述
注:war版本的目录里面多了一个flowable-rest.war,该功能主要提供对flowable的rest接口,rest通过统一的restful接口来服务,主要有部署管理、任务管理、流程管理等功能,可以不通过JAVA API来调用相关接口。
以上的war包都需要通过idm包提供的用户单点登录服务,所以必须启动idm服务。

二、Flowable部署包启动

2.1. tomcat版本

tomcat版本比较简单,在下载的安装包中已经有了start.bat,单击启动即可,等待多个war包启动成功。
在这里插入图片描述
注意tomcat的默认端口是8080,所有的服务都从8080可以进入。

2.2. war版本

由于Flowable集成了springboot,war版本通过jar -jar 就可以完成启动。

2.2.1 启动flowable-idm

 java -jar .\flowable-idm.war

启动如下图所示,默认端口8080:
在这里插入图片描述

http://localhost:8080/flowable-idm/

在这里插入图片描述
在这里插入图片描述

2.2.2 启动flowable-modeler

java -jar .\flowable-modeler.war

默认端口8888
在这里插入图片描述

http://localhost:8080/flowable-modeler/

在这里插入图片描述

2.2.3 启动flowable-admin管理程序

默认端口为9988

java -jar flowable-admin.war

启动如下图所示:
在这里插入图片描述
在这里插入图片描述

2.2.4 启动flowable-task

java -jar flowable-task.war

任务管理程序的默认端口是9999,启动过程如下图所示:
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

2.2.5 启动flowable-rest

rest服务程序的默认端口是8080,主要提供通过rest-api(JSON格式)来访问flowable的能力。通过

java -jar flowable-rest.war --server.port=8081

(注意和UI冲突可以停止idm服务,也可以指定端口启动 后面加上参数 --server.port=8081)
启动如下:
在这里插入图片描述
在这里插入图片描述
启动后,我们可以进入页面查看UI页面,后面我们会详细介绍每个Web服务的相关功能。
在这里插入图片描述

接下一篇:
第3篇:Flowable-IDM详述
https://blog.csdn.net/weixin_40816738/article/details/102885902

  • 1
    点赞
  • 4
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

gblfy

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值